The Palestinian Soap Cooperative works with traditional makers of Palestinian olive oil soap from Nablus, a city that has continuously produced pure olive oil soap for the past thousand years. They support local farmers along with the artisans to keep the Palestinian culture and tradition around olive oil thriving for the next millennia.
'The Land' is made by the Women's Soap Co-operative of Beita, just south of Nablus. The newest of the Nablus soap brands, Al-Ard is a third-generation family-run Palestinian grocery company founded in 2008 in order to provide local farmers with modern facilities and a global customer base. The Anabtawi family has deep roots in Nablus and manages the production of this soap.
Since they work in small batches and are connected with many local small producers, their olive oil is often among the very best. The cooperative's equipment is all stainless steel and run electrically, compared with other brands which use gas or wood burning furnaces to cook their soap.
Nablus soap is the only 100% olive oil soap still produced in the traditional way. Made from three ingredients --- olive oil, water, and lye --- it is cooked slowly on high heat for a week, before being hand cut, stacked, and dried for up to 8 months. It is unscented and is great for cleaning veggies, dishes, and your soil worn gardener hands.
